  14. Wassail 2024

    Address

    Pensford Field, 17-19 Pensford Avenue, Kew, London, TW9 4HR

    Telephone

    07540 716 404

    Kew

    Dates

    A Wassail is an old English custom to encourage the good health of fruit trees. This is a fun event in Pensford Field - funny hats, costumes and noisy instruments are encouraged. Music, singing and dancing with the wonderful UKewLele. Traditional…
